摘要
目前,高校计算机公共课教学大多仍然采用传统灌输式、单向式的教学方法,不利于学生自学能力和创新能力的培养。而在建构主义教学理论基础上形成的“任务驱动”教学法,不仅能够调动学生学习的兴趣,而且有利于培养学生的实践能力、自学能力和创新能力。“任务驱动”教学法的关键在于任务设计。任务设计要合理、科学。当然,“任务驱动”教学法也并不适用计算机课程的所有教学内容,教师在选择使用“任务驱动”教学法时应特别注意教学内容的适用性。
At present, the college computer teaching of the non-computer majors mostly still adopts the traditional teaching method, this kind of method is a unidirectional inculcating method,it is bad to develop the students' independent study ability and their innovation ability. The task-driving method which not only conforms to the students' cognitive regularity, but also conforms to the characteristic of the computer courses not only helps to fully arouse the students' interest of study, but also helps to train their practice ability, their independent study ability and their innovation ability. The key of the task-driving method lies in the design of the task. The design of the task must be rational. Certainly, the task-driving method is not suitable to all content of the computer courses, teachers should pay special attention to the suitability of the content of the courses while choosing to use the task-driving method.
